Rick and Morty face a foe unlike any they've seen before. Well, it's basically Jerry, but he's huge, fast, vicious, and... naked? Rick has the perfect a giant mech fighting robot, perfectly designed and calibrated to take on the Jiant horde—but it needs a puny, socially isolated, 14-year-old pilot. Oh, we've got one! Summer, Morty, and his charming new friend Rowan navigate this violent post-apocalyptic world, where they still have to go to high school and Rick seems oddly invested in upgrading the mech with stylish new features.
ALISSA SALLAH is a cartoonist (and cosplayer) from small town Ohio. She edits and contributes to the Bonfire Yearly Anthology (STRATOS, TOPIA, SILK & METAL), has been featured in the BITCH PLANET Triple Feature, the YAKUZA 6 SONG OF LIFE artbook and was the colorist on the Image comic series SLEEPLESS. ‘Rick and Morty: The Manga, Vol. 1: Get in the Robot, Morty!’ cleverly adapts the irreverent humour and wild adventures of the original series into the manga format, introducing a thrilling storyline where Morty pilots a giant robot reminiscent of 'Mobile Suit Gundam' to combat colossal adversaries similar to 'Attack on Titan's giants. The transition to manga preserves the essence of the characters and their quirky mannerisms, making it a delightful read for fans and newcomers alike who enjoy a blend of science fiction and humour with a unique twist.
